 **Segments**

– **Type**: The low-cost satellite market can be segmented based on the type of satellite, including nano, micro, and mini satellites. Nano satellites are typically weighing between 1-10 kg, micro satellites between 10-100 kg, and mini satellites between 100-500 kg. Each type offers different capabilities and cost-effectiveness, attracting different market segments.
– **Application**: Another crucial segmentation is based on the application of low-cost satellites. These can vary from communication, earth observation, scientific research, technology development, and more. The diverse applications cater to different industries’ needs and requirements, driving the demand for low-cost satellite services.
– **End-User**: Low-cost satellites are utilized by various end-users, such as defense & security, government, commercial, and research institutions. Understanding the specific requirements of each end-user segment is essential for targeting the right market and customizing satellite solutions accordingly.

**Market Players**

– **NanoAvionics**: NanoAvionics is a key player in the low-cost satellite market, offering a range of nano and micro satellite solutions. The company focuses on providing cost-effective and reliable satellite platforms for various applications, including technology demonstration, Earth observation, and communication.
– **GomSpace**: GomSpace is another prominent player specializing in nanosatellite solutions. The company provides end-to-end services, from satellite design and manufacturing to launch and in-orbit operations. Their innovative approach to low-cost satellite technology has positioned them as a leader in the market.
– **Clyde Space**: Clyde Space is known for its expertise in designing and manufacturing small satellites, including CubeSats and small satellite platforms. The company’s emphasis on high-quality and affordable satellite solutions has earned them a strong presence in the low-cost satellite market.

One of the emerging trends in the market is the growing interest in constellation-based satellite systems. Constellations of small satellites offer improved coverage, flexibility, and redundancy compared to traditional large satellites. Companies are exploring the potential of constellation systems for applications such as global connectivity, Earth observation, and IoT services. This trend is reshaping the competitive landscape of the low-cost satellite market, with both established players and new entrants focusing on developing constellation capabilities.

Additionally, the market is witnessing a surge in public-private partnerships for satellite missions. Governments, space agencies, and commercial entities are collaborating to leverage each other’s strengths in satellite technology development, deployment, and operation. These partnerships enable shared resources, expertise, and funding, leading to more cost-effective and sustainable satellite programs. Moreover, the increasing prevalence of advanced technologies such as AI, machine learning, and data analytics is enhancing the capabilities of low-cost satellites. These technologies empower satellites to collect, process, and transmit data more efficiently, enabling new applications and services across different industries.

Furthermore, the low-cost satellite market is expanding its geographical reach, with a growing focus on emerging markets in Asia-Pacific, Latin America, and Africa. These regions offer untapped opportunities for satellite providers to address specific needs related to connectivity, disaster monitoring, agriculture, and environmental management. The market players are adapting their strategies to cater to the unique requirements of these markets, including affordable pricing, localized services, and technology transfer partnerships. This geographic diversification is driving innovation and competition in the low-cost satellite market, leading to the development of tailored solutions for diverse end-user segments.

Global Low-Cost Satellite Market, By Satellite Type (Mini-satellite, Micro-satellite, and Nano-satellite):
– Mini-satellite: Mini satellites, weighing between 100-500 kg, are gaining popularity for their capabilities in different applications such as Earth observation and communication.
– Micro-satellite: Falling in the weight range of 10-100 kg, micro satellites are versatile and cost-effective, making them ideal for various industries’ requirements.
– Nano-satellite: Nano satellites, typically weighing between 1-10 kg, are known for their affordability and suitability for missions like technology demonstration and scientific research.

By Application (Low-Cost Communication Satellite and Low-Cost Imaging Satellite):
– Low-Cost Communication Satellite: These satellites focus on providing cost-effective communication solutions, catering to the increasing demand for connectivity services globally.
– Low-Cost Imaging Satellite: Low-cost imaging satellites offer affordable Earth observation capabilities, enabling industries to access critical data for applications like agriculture, disaster monitoring, and environmental management.

By End Use (Military, Civil, and Commercial):
– Military: The military sector utilizes low-cost satellites for applications such as reconnaissance, surveillance, and communication, enhancing strategic capabilities and situational awareness.
– Civil: In the civil sector, low-cost satellites support missions related to disaster response, urban planning, climate monitoring, and infrastructure development, benefiting society as a whole.
– Commercial: Commercial entities leverage low-cost satellites for various purposes, including telecommunications, navigation, remote sensing, and asset tracking, driving operational efficiency and market competitiveness.
